Splitgate

Description: Splitgate is a free-to-play first-person shooter video game developed by 1047 Games. It combines fast-paced portal mechanics with the gameplay of more traditional FPS games like Halo and Call of Duty. The game features customizable characters, a variety of maps and game modes, and cross-platform play.

Total Overdose

Description: Total Overdose is an open world third-person shooter video game released in 2005. Players control Ramiro Cruz, an ex-convict who battles a drug cartel to avenge his father's death. Gameplay involves shooting, driving vehicles, and completing missions with crazy stunts and exaggerated physics.
